Cats Be Like: Expressing Themselves Loudly (and Quietly)

Purrfect cats are masters of communication, even if it sometimes seems like they're speaking an ancient tongue. They can express themselves with a whole range of vocalizations, from the loud meow that requests on their breakfast to the soft purr that signifies contentment. But don't be fooled by the volume, because cats are also experts in delicate communication. A flick of the tail, a twitch of the ear, even a slow blink can speak volumes. So next time your feline friend acting strangely, pay attention to all the signals they're giving you. You might be surprised by what you learn!
